We Inspect All Types of Construction

From modern construction techniques to traditional and eco-friendly builds, Noble Home Inspection, LLC has the experience to handle it all.

​

We inspect:

  • Contemporary residential & commercial construction

  • Log homes and timber frame cabins

  • Eco builds such as:

    • Yurts

    • Straw bale homes

    • Sod homes

    • Cob structures

    • And other alternative builds

 We Inspect Alternative Electrical & Water Systems

At Noble Home Inspection, LLC, we understand that many Alaskan properties operate off-grid or use non-traditional utility systems. We're trained and equipped to inspect a variety of alternative electrical and water setups, including:

    Electrical Systems:

  • Solar panel arrays

  • Battery storage systems

  • Off-grid inverters & controllers

  • Backup generators

  • Wind or micro-hydro setups

     Water Systems:

  • Cisterns and rainwater catchment systems

  • Gravity-fed water lines

  • Water purification & filtration units

  • Wells and hand-pump systems

  • Greywater recycling setups
